I feel like they a mad breast scientists some days.... lol... Over the holidays I had some time so I went to the hardware store and picked up some pipe.... The problem I've always had with suction devices was they were independent domes and while they centered over my breasts the never centered over my nipples.... this always seemed to cause lopsided growth.... so I built single dome with two openings that are centered over my nipples.... and so far the swelling I'm getting is also centered too... Made from 2 3" pvc elbows... glued together... the openings were also angled to fit my chest perfectly... and the inside was totally carved out to remove any sharp transitions.... I installed a nylon barb nipple to connect a hose to any pump.... Its very comfortable to wear but because it effects your entire chest... too much negative pressure can make it harder to breath!

basically I use a suction device like a Brava or a noogleberry a couple hours a day, 5 or 6 days a week..... and it works!

the hardware store is full of good items... and the automotive store... a basic pumps can be purchased from any auto part store... or Harbor Freight... its a brake bleed system... Hoses don't come off... vacuum hoses... domes can be made from PVC pipe caps... or mugs or anything that fits your size.. For as little as $25 you can build a basic one... biggest thing is to be creative.... and make sure that there are no leaks.... a few of the ones I've built without hoses will stay attached for hours without repumping.....
Speaking of pumps..... here's a 12 volt vacuum pump I made from a tire inflater pump.... Added a brass nipple to the inlet side using JB Weld epoxy... works great in the car... on a trip...
